Researchers found record-breaking rates of sea-level rise of about a half an inch per year since 2010, three times higher than the global average over the same period. The acceleration is attributed to man-made climate change and natural climate variability.

The Arctic permafrost is home to thousands of industrial sites storing hazardous substances. As climate change accelerates thawing, these contaminants can be released, causing irreparable damage to ecosystems. The study estimates 13,000 to 20,000 contaminated sites in the region.

Researchers discovered a microbial culture from baby kangaroo feces that can inhibit methane production in cow stomach simulators, replacing it with beneficial acetic acid. This innovation has the potential to mitigate greenhouse gas emissions and improve cow health.

A recent study compiled over 125,000 river locations across 93 countries, showing that hypoxia in rivers is more prevalent than previously thought. The research found that 12.6% of all locations exhibited at least one hypoxic measurement, with warmer, smaller, and lower-gradient waters being most affected.

Measurements taken by University of Copenhagen researchers show high air pollution levels in the Copenhagen metro, with ultra-small particles 10-20 times higher than on heavily trafficked streets. The pollution comes mainly from trains' brakes and rails, posing a health risk to frequent users.

Researchers found that microplastic mass sequestered in seafloor sediments mimics global plastic production from 1965 to 2016. The study revealed a tripling of microplastics deposited on the seafloor since 2000, with accumulation rates mirroring global use of plastics.
